Turn the VOL control knob to the right to increase
volume or to the left to decrease volume.
MENU button (BASS, TREBLE, FADE,
BALANCE and CLOCK)
Press the MENU button to change the mode as
follows:
BAS
→ TRE → FAD → BAL → CLOCK → BAS
To adjust Bass, Treble, Fade and Balance, press
the MENU button until the desired mode appears
in the display. Press the
SEEK
but-
ton to adjust Bass and Treble to the desired level.
You can also use the
SEEK
button
to adjust Fade and Balance modes. Balance ad-
justs the sound between the right and left speak-
ers. Since this vehicle is not equipped with rear
speakers, adjusting the fade to the rear of the
vehicle will reduce the volume until no sound is
played.
Once you have adjusted the sound quality to the
desired level, press the MENU button repeatedly
until the radio or CD display reappears. Other-
wise, the radio or CD display will automatically
reappear after about 10 seconds.

Clock operation
Press the MENU button until CLOCK is dis-
played; use the
SEEK
button to turn
the clock display on (CLK ON) or off (CLK OFF).
Clock set
If the clock is not displayed with the ignition
switch in the ACC or ON position, you need to
select the CLK ON mode. Press the MENU but-
ton repeatedly until CLOCK is displayed. Use
the
SEEK
button to enable CLK ON
mode.
1. Press the MENU button repeatedly until
CLOCK mode appears; press the
SEEK
button until CLK ON appears.
2. Press the MENU button again; the hours will
start flashing.
3. Press the
SEEK
button to ad-
just the hour.
4. Press the MENU button again; the display
will switch to the minute adjustment mode.
5. The minutes will start flashing. Press
SEEK
button to adjust the minutes.
6. Press the MENU button again to exit the
clock set mode.
The display will return to the regular clock display
after 10 seconds, or press the MENU button
again to return to the regular clock display.
Resetting the time
Hold the MENU button down and then press the
TUNE or SEEK button; the time will reset as
follows:
● If the displayed minutes before the reset are
in the range of :00 - :29, the hour displayed
before the reset will stay the same and the
minutes will be reset to :00.
● If the displayed minutes before the reset are
in the range of :30 - :59, the hour displayed
before the reset will advance by one hour
and the minutes will be reset to :00.
